What is Tableau?
Tableau is a visual analytics platform transforming the way we use data to solve problems—empowering people and organizations to make the most of their data. From connection through collaboration, Tableau is a powerful, secure, and flexible end-to-end analytics platform.

How to read the Emotional Footprint
The Net Emotional Footprint measures high-level user sentiment towards particular product offerings. It aggregates emotional response ratings for various dimensions of the vendor-client relationship and product effectiveness, creating a powerful indicator of overall user feeling toward the vendor and product.
While purchasing decisions shouldn't be based on emotion, it's valuable to know what kind of emotional response the vendor you're considering elicits from their users.

Strong Business Intelligence Tool
Likeliness to Recommend
What differentiates Tableau from other similar products?
Tableau stands out through its intuitive drag-and-drop interface and ability to transform complex datasets into interactive visualizations with minimal effort. The platform balances ease of use with advanced analytical capabilities, enabling both business users and data professionals to uncover insights quickly and communicate findings effectively.
What is your favorite aspect of this product?
My favorite aspect is the flexibility in creating interactive dashboards. The ability to connect to multiple data sources, customize visualizations, and drill down into details helps users explore data from different perspectives without requiring extensive technical expertise.
What do you dislike most about this product?
The main drawback is that performance can sometimes slow when working with very large datasets or highly complex dashboards. Additionally, licensing costs may be challenging for smaller organizations, and some advanced features require a learning curve for new users.
What recommendations would you give to someone considering this product?
I recommend starting with a clear understanding of your reporting and analytics requirements before implementation. Invest time in user training and dashboard design best practices to maximize value. Tableau is particularly effective for organizations seeking self-service analytics and visually engaging business intelligence solutions.
